Output d339e9d28098939ce73631b83ecb230955d7ce60b6304f3e90cf221b937400e8:6

value
664006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 028e716c9438f0eac1b060e1a99009739785550c OP_EQUAL
address
31vXv3ZSTHhe85UavhCcmaEiEdLLU1bEJi
transaction
d339e9d28098939ce73631b83ecb230955d7ce60b6304f3e90cf221b937400e8
spent
true